^ The highlight of the day's festivities was mass, concelebrated by the Archbishop of San Salvador, current and past members of the CLAM (Cleveland mission) Team (Fr. Joe came all the way from La Union!), Zaragoza pastor Fr. Adonai, and Fr. Ken's first seminary vocation, Fr. Manuel Cardona. In attendance were students, alumni, Zaragoza town folk (including mayor Dany Rodriquez), and visitors from the US including Sisters of Charity, Myers family members, and COAR Board members.
